Westport Cops Go Green — Add Tesla To The Fleet

Savvy drivers know what our police cars look like.

They look like cop cars everywhere.

But this is Westport. The next time you’re pulled over, it may be by a … Tesla.

The newest addition to the Police Department fleet is a fully electric 2020 Tesla Model 3. The 310 mile-range electric vehicle has already been delivered. It’s being outfitted now with all the necessary equipment: emergency lights, siren, computer, weapon rack, and tires capable of speeds over 100 miles an hour.

It’s expected to hit the mean streets of Westport by the end of January.

Police Chief Foti Koskinas says he “believes in being green.” But his main reason for choosing a Tesla was superior performance, crash ratings, and collision avoidance technology.

Officers will pass on the autopilot feature.

While the purchase price of $52,290 is higher than the $37,000 the department normally spends adding another Ford Explorer, Koskinas expects to more than make up for that in fuel and maintenance savings.

Just in the first 3 years, an internal combustion engine squad car requires about $11,000 in oil changes, oil filters, tuneups and brakes.

Teslas require no annual maintenance. Brakes last 70,000 miles or more, thanks to a motor system that slows the car while simultaneously recharging the battery.

A new look for the Westport Police Department fleet.

Savings on gas are significant too. The Department of Energy’s fuel economy calculator shows the Police Department’s cost per mile will be $0.040. The fuel cost for a Ford Explorer is $0.127 per mile — saving $13,770 in the first 3 years.

Charging the battery is not an issue. The vehicle is expected to be used 200 to 220 miles a day. The police already have a gas pump on their property. They’ll add a Level 2 electric vehicle charger, which will take just a few hours overnight.

The cop car will join the 431 electric vehicles already owned by Westporters. 250 are Teslas. That puts us #1 in the state in both categories (per capita).

EV Club president Bruce Becker believes Westport is the first police department on the East Coast with a Tesla.

FUN FACTS:

  • The Model 3 has an extra trunk in the front of the vehicle where an internal combustion engine would usually be. Officers can use it to store emergency equipment that must be kept separate from cargo in the rear trunk.
  • Every Tesla comes straight from the factory with features like front, side and rear-view cameras that a police department would typically install at extra cost. They can also be used in “sentry mode” to monitor the vehicle and vicinity when it’s parked.
  • The Model 3 has a top speed of 162 mph — faster than all other vehicles in the current fleet.
  • Police cars spend lots of time idling. An internal combustion engine must run to power the lights and keep online computers running while not draining the battery. The Tesla will eliminate those tailpipe emissions.
  • This is not the first EV for Westport’s Police Department. In 2007, a Toyota Prius replaced a car that burned 7 to 9 gallons of gas every day. The current Prius is a plug-in hybrid, but operates almost exclusively in electric-only mode for its daily driving needs.
